Australia vs Türkiye World Cup 2026 Match Preview
The World Cup Group Stage meeting between Australia and Türkiye is scheduled for 2026 at BC Place in Vancouver. Both sides enter this Group D campaign opener with the standings showing zero matches played, zero points, and no goals scored or conceded so far. There is no indication of a knockout tie, so this is firmly a group-phase fixture rather than a 1/8 final.
